媒体でファッションコラムを執筆したり、講演を行なったりと、
ファッションに関して色々な発信を行なっていく中で
やっぱりこのブログを自分のホームとして大事にしたいな、という思いが強くなったため
もっと、記事の一覧性を高めて読みやすくするべく、
デザインリニューアルを行ないました。
少し前にアメブロからWordPressに移行したので
デザインの自由度は格段に高くなりました。
今回は 国産の「Tanzaku」というテーマをベースにカスタマイズ。
色々と考えましたが、やっぱりファッションコンテンツは
現状では、グリッドデザインが一番読みやすいと思うんですよねぇ~
ちなみに、私は「Tanzaku」のHTML5版を使わせていただきましたよ。
WordPressテーマ tanzaku のHTML5版を作ってみた | もしもワークス
こちらのページで配布されています。
いやはや、簡単なカスタマイズで済ませるはずが
一度始めるとやっぱりあれこれいじりたくなってしまってかなりハマりました・・・
※その時の悲痛な叫びはぜひ私のFacebookでご覧下さい・・・
どんなに探しても解決法が見当たらなかったのですが
なんとか自力で這い出しましたので
以下に備忘録を。
記事詳細ページで下部に記事一覧が展開されない
今の状態を見ていただければわかると思うのですが
このテーマでは、記事の詳細ページの下に、TOPページ同様、
記事一覧が短冊のようにずらっと展開されます。
これが好きでこのテーマに変えたというのに
私のブログに適用すると、同じ記事が2つ繰り返し表示されるだけになってしまう!!
カスタマイズする前のスタイルシートに戻しても問題が解決されなかったため
もしや、と思いプラグインを一つずつ消していくと、
Facebookのコメント欄といいねボタンを記事一つずつに設置できるプラグイン
「Facebook Comments for WordPress」との相性が悪かったみたいです・・・
先月、Facebook公式のプラグインがリリースされたようだったので
そちらをインストールしたところ、表示が正常になりました。
(って簡単に書いてるけど、ここまで来るのにかなり時間かかったのよね・・・)
なんだかよくわからないPHPエラーに泣かされる
もう、これは未だに原因がわからないのですが
トップページに「Warning: split() [function.split]: REG_EMPTY」うんちゃらかんちゃら・・・と
エラーが出てしまったのです。
どうやら「functions.php」の69行目が悪さをしているようで
どれどれと見てみると「$split_url = split($mark, $img_url);」と書いてある。
・・・・これ、何語・・・・?
私、HTMLとCSSの読み書きはできますが、
さすがにPHPはムリ!
神様(=Google)に聞いても、出てくる言葉がなんのことやらさっぱり。
某有名掲示板で質問したところ、splitっていうのが今は非推奨で使ってはいけない関数なんだとか。
そもそもどれが関数でどれがそうじゃないのかわからない。
そして文系としては「関数」という言葉だけでもうアレルギーーー
だから、えいやっと。
消してしまいました!!!そのあたりの箇所をざっくりと!!!!
一応ブラウザチェックいろいろして、全部まともに動いてるんでもう勘弁して下さい・・・
というわけで、今回の反省点としては
新しいテーマを導入する際には、まず素の状態で適用してエラーが出ないか確認してから
カスタマイズしましょうね
ということですね。
ごりごりカスタマイズした後に、あれこれエラーが起こると
心労が激しいです。
(これを生業にしている人はほんとにすごいと思った・・・)